Is 无花果 safe for people with kidney disease?
无花果 is rated Safe for CKD patients. Good choice for kidney disease patients. With 14.0mg phosphorus, 1.0mg sodium, and 232.0mg potassium per 100.0g serving, it can be enjoyed in normal portion sizes. Always confirm with your nephrologist or renal dietitian.
How much phosphorus is in 无花果?
A 100.0g serving of 无花果 contains 14mg of phosphorus, which is approximately 1% of the recommended 1,000mg daily limit for CKD Stage 3-4 patients.
How much sodium is in 无花果?
Per 100.0g serving, 无花果 provides 1mg of sodium — about 0% of the 2,300mg daily sodium limit recommended for kidney patients.
How much potassium is in 无花果?
无花果 contains 232mg of potassium per 100.0g serving, equivalent to about 12% of the daily 2,000mg potassium limit for CKD Stage 3-4 patients.
Can dialysis patients eat 无花果?
Dialysis patients have stricter mineral limits. Given 无花果 is rated Safe (Good choice for kidney disease patients), it is generally a good choice for dialysis patients in normal portions. Your dialysis team can give you personalised portion advice.
